  1. May 19, 2023 · Set GIF as desktop background in Windows 10/11. Step 1: Open the Microsoft Store app and search for Lively Wallpaper. Click on the Install button to download and install it. Step 2: Launch the Lively Wallpaper app. If the Lively Wallpaper app does not show its window, right-click on its icon in the system tray and click Open Lively.

    It's pretty hard to judge the difference between the usability of the apps and the overall GUI experience. I prefer the simplicity and layout of LIvely Wallpaper more. Still, Wallpaper Engine has many more options to help you find exactly what you're looking for, and the 'Discover' tab in Wallpaper Engine is a huge bonus. 

    Besides a few basic pre-loaded wallpapers that come with Lively Wallpaper, any other wallpapers you want to use must come from outside the app. This is a bit of a bummer compared to Wallpaper Engine and does require a bit more work, but in the long run, it means it supports a vast range of different inputs, such as websites, YouTube videos, and nearly all video files. If you're looking for ideas or help with Lively Wallpaper, they have an active subreddit with users uploading new wallpaper creations and offering assistance in true open-source fashion. 

    If you're looking for convenience and ease of use, Wallpaper Engine's Discover tab does all the work for you, showcasing awesome wallpapers from different categories. It's almost impossible not to find a great-looking Wallpaper for any taste. Of course, the Workshop tab also allows you to search for anything you are dying to place from and center on your PC setup.  

    •TL;DR app usability: While Lively Wallpaper has an overall cleaner aesthetic, in my opinion, and is very easy to drive and move around, the actual act of finding, downloading, and 'installing' wallpapers is much easier on Wallpaper Engine due to the Discover and Workshop tabs that feed community-created content directly into the app and offer 'one-click shopping' for the avid wallpaper connoisseur.

    I was surprised to see how much running a live wallpaper affected my GPU. I purchased the recently reviewed NVIDIA RTX 4070 Super, and I thought I would have a ton of overhead running these live wallpapers. That doesn't seem to be the case, though. Any live wallpaper I tried had my GPU utilization showing between 15% and 30%, but it was over 20% most of the time. This was the same across both Wallpaper Engine and Lively Wallpaper.

    Lively Wallpaper also uses a lot of GPU when running a live wallpaper. It is important to say that I have no reason to doubt either of these apps' claims that they will reduce utilization to 0% during gaming. I didn't notice any slowdown or drop in frames while gaming with live wallpapers enabled from either of these applications. 

    Honestly, I'm torn. Before starting this, I thought that Lively Wallpaper, undoubtedly the best free alternative to Wallpaper Engine on the market, would be able to win. Still, after using both, I think the most significant deciding factor is the Workshop and Discover tabs in Wallpaper Engine. This might not be the case for everybody, but for me, $4 is not worth the extra time it would take to scour Bing trying to find the perfect video, GIF, or other media to make a wallpaper through Lively Wallpapers. 

    But if you're looking for a free solution and want to get involved in making and creating custom wallpapers, the Lively Wallpaper community is active and alive and always looking for more users to jump in and assist in improving it. 

    I understand if $4 is too much for you to spend on a wallpaper app, and Lively Wallpaper is an excellent option for anybody who wants to use it. Still, if you just want to download an app, find a gorgeous wallpaper, and enjoy Geralt of Rivia bobbing up and down on your desktop, Wallpaper Engine is easily worth the $3.99.
